The purpose of statistical inference is to make estimates or draw conclusions about a.
Free_Kalibri [48]

<u>When we make estimates of or draw conclusions about one or more characteristics of a population based upon the </u><u>sample</u><u>, we are using the process of </u><u>statistical inference</u><u>.</u>

  • To estimate this sample to sample variance or uncertainty is the goal of statistical inference.

What is the purpose of statistical inferences ?

  • To be able to make inferences about a population based on data from a sample is the goal of statistical inference.
  • The process of statistical inference involves selecting a sample, gathering data from that sample, calculating a statistic from the data, and drawing conclusions about the population from that statistic.

How is statistical inference used to draw conclusions?

Estimation and hypothesis testing are components of statistical inference (evaluating a notion about a population using a sample) (estimating the value or potential range of values of some characteristic of the population based on that of a sample).

A company that rents small moving trucks wants to purchase 25 trucks with a combined capacity of 28,000 cubic feet. Three differ
pickupchik [31]

Answer:

We have 4 solutions:

  • No 10-foot truck, 10  14-foot trucks, and 15 24-foot trucks
  • 2 10-foot trucks, 7 14-foot trucks, and 16 24-foot trucks
  • 4 10-foot trucks, 4  14-foot trucks, and 17 24-foot trucks
  • 6 10-foot trucks, 1 14-foot trucks, and 18 24-foot trucks

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the number of 10-foot truck with a capacity of 350 cubic feet purchased=a

Let the number of 14-foot truck with a capacity of 700 cubic feet purchased=b

Let the number of 24-foot truck with a capacity of 1,400 cubic feet purchased=c

The company wants to purchase 25 trucks, therefore.

  • a+b+c=25

Furthermore, the combined capacity of the trucks is 28,000 cubic feet.

  • 350a+700b+1400c=28000

Since the number of equations is less than the number of variables, you can not use a matrix equation to solve this problem.  The solution is most easily found using an augmented matrix.  

The augmented matrix is presented below:  

\left[\begin{array}{ccc|c}1&1&1&25\\350&700&1400&28000\end{array}\right]

Using the calculator, the reduced row echelon form is:

\left[\begin{array}{ccc|c}1&0&-2&-30\\0&1&3&55\end{array}\right]

where  

a- 2c=-30 means a =2c-30

b+3c=55 means b= 55-3c

We alter the value of c as long as neither a nor b becomes negative. Suitable values for c are 15, 16, 17, and 18:

\left|\begin{array}{|c||c||c|}a=2c-30&b=55-3c&c\\0&10&15\\2&7&16\\4&4&17\\6&1&18\end{array}\right|

We can easily  verify that, for each solution, the number of trucks adds up to 25 and the fleet capacity is 28,000 cubic feet.

We therefore have 4 solutions:

  • No 10-foot truck, 10  14-foot trucks, and 15 24-foot trucks
  • 2 10-foot trucks, 7 14-foot trucks, and 16 24-foot trucks
  • 4 10-foot trucks, 4  14-foot trucks, and 17 24-foot trucks
  • 6 10-foot trucks, 1 14-foot trucks, and 18 24-foot trucks
